Janice A Neame backgrounds her nursing experience and educational qualifications gained through S A N S (School of Advanced Nursing Studies) and a B.A as extra-mural student with a double major in nursing and psychology from Massey University, before becoming Chief Nurse at Marlborough Hospital. Recalls involvement in the transfer of nursing education from hospitals to polytechnics, initially affecting the Marlborough Hospital and the Nelson Polytechnic and being well prepared for the Otago transfer. Took up position as Chief Nurse in 1983 and explains the two programmes operating at Otago, the R G O N and the Psychiatric Nursing Programme. Explains how the transition differed from the Nelson experience. Mentions Leonie Clent. Argues for different types of induction and inservice programmes in order to integrate comprehensive nurses into the work force and cites mental health managers' concerns about newly graduated staff being able to practice. After ten years as Chief Nurse left in 1993 - following one of the reforms, position was disestablished. Discusses position as Director of Programmes and Planning, Otago Area Health Board and involvement with psychiatric services which lasted four years. Talks about position at Waipukarau, Pukerora, as head of a long term rehabilitation plan for severe head trauma victims, and development of a project enabling people with physical disabilities to go home. Mentions husband (David Bolitho) getting a job in Timaru which meant another move and discusses current position in Community Health Services which includes mental health services.
